Tyson Fury Announces Shock Retirement from Boxing Amid Cryptic Message
In a shocking turn of events, former heavyweight champion Tyson Fury has announced his retirement from professional boxing. The news comes amidst speculation about a potential showdown with Anthony Joshua.
Fury took to social media to break the news, posting a five-word message that left fans and critics alike scratching their heads. “I’m done, I’m free now.”
This cryptic message led many to speculate about his reasons for retiring, particularly given recent hints from promoter Eddie Hearn about a potential Wembley showdown with Anthony Joshua.
Fury’s decision to hang up his gloves has sent shockwaves through the boxing community, leaving fans and fellow fighters stunned. The 37-year-old had been expected to return to the ring in the near future, but it appears those plans have been scrapped.
